Shops, malls to remain closed for two days ahead of polls
All shops, commercial outlets, and shopping malls across Bangladesh, including the capital Dhaka, will remain closed for two days ahead of the 13th National Parliament election, the Bangladesh Shop Owners’ Association announced Tuesday (February 10).
The decision, covering February 11 and 12, was taken at a joint meeting of the Bangladesh Shop Owners’ Association and the Dhaka Metropolitan Shop Owners’ Association standing committee, the association said in a statement signed by President Md. Nazmul Hasan Mahmud.
The closures coincide with government-declared election holidays to ensure smooth voting.
Earlier, the Ministry of Public Administration issued a three-day official holiday notification, effective February 11–13, covering all government, semi-government, autonomous, and private offices, as well as schools and educational institutions.
Additionally, a special holiday has been declared on February 10 for workers and staff in industrial zones to facilitate their participation in the election.
